🇰🇭 Cambodia's Greenhouse Gas Emissions

Population 17.64 Million, Asia.  Read key messages

Key Messages

  • Emissions: Cambodia emitted around 92.8 megatonnes CO2e in 2024, about 0.16% of the global total.
  • Per person: Emissions were around 5.3 tonnes per person per year in 2024, rated high on a scale where any level above zero adds warming.
  • Trend: Emissions fell by around 0.17% a year over the ten years to 2024, far slower than the 4% yearly decline the world needs to achieve Net Zero in 2050 and limit warming to around 1.7 °C.
  • What drives it: CO2 made up around 68% of Cambodia's emissions, methane 26%, nitrous oxide 4.9% and F-gases 0.76%.
  • Historic responsibility: Since 1851, Cambodia's emissions have produced around 7,260 megatonnes CO2e of warming impact, about 0.19% of the global total, or around 7.4 tonnes per person per year.
